Two of the top teams in the Atlantic Division will collide when the Boston Bruins take on the Buffalo Sabres in the first round of the 2026 NHL Playoffs.
Boston clinched the top wild-card spot in the Eastern Conference with a 100-point season, though it did stumble down the stretch. David Pastrnak and Jeremy Swayman will look to lead the Bruins to an upset against the division champions.
The Sabres are back in the playoffs for the first time since the 2010-11 season. Buffalo ended the regular season on a high note, winning four of its last five games on the way to 109 points, the second-highest mark in the conference. Tage Thompson leads the attack with 40 goals and 81 points, while Rasmus Dahlin has a team-high 55 assists.

Sabres vs. Bruins Game 1 will air on ESPN, with Mike Monaco and Ray Ferraro on the call.
Fans can stream the game live on DIRECTV, which offers a free trial to new users, along with the ESPN app or fubo, which also has a free trial.
Sabres vs. Bruins is scheduled to start at 7:30 p.m. ET on Sunday, April 19. Game 1 will be played at the KeyBank Center in Buffalo, N.Y.
| Date | Game | Time (ET) | National |
|---|---|---|---|
| April 19 | Game 1: Bruins vs. Sabres | 7:30 p.m. | ESPN, ESPN app, fubo, DIRECTV |
| April 21 | Game 2: Bruins vs. Sabres | 7:30 p.m. | ESPN, ESPN app, fubo, DIRECTV |
| April 23 | Game 3: Sabres vs. Bruins | 7 p.m. | TNT, truTV, DIRECTV |
| April 26 | Game 4: Sabres vs. Bruins | 2 p.m. | TNT, truTV, DIRECTV |
| April 28 | Game 5*: Bruins vs. Sabres | TBD | TBD |
| May 1 | Game 6*: Sabres vs. Bruins | TBD | TBD |
| May 3 | Game 7*: Bruins vs. Sabres | TBD | TBD |
*If necessary

Here are the key dates to know for the NHL Playoffs:
| Event | Dates |
|---|---|
| First round begins | April 18 |
| Second round begins | May 2* |
| Conference finals begin | May 17* |
| Stanley Cup Final begins | June 3* |
| Last possible day for Game 7 | June 21 |
*Can move up depending on earlier series
